HOST: Welcome to our podcast, today I'm thrilled to be speaking with an expert in Quality Improvement principles. Can you tell us a bit about why these principles are so vital for professionals today? GUEST: Absolutely, Quality Improvement principles are essential in various industries like healthcare and manufacturing. They help improve efficiency, reduce waste, and drive positive change by equipping professionals with crucial tools and techniques for process optimization. HOST: That's fascinating. Could you share some current trends in this field that make learning about Quality Improvement even more important? GUEST: Of course. Lean methodologies and Six Sigma are increasingly being adopted across industries. Additionally, data analysis skills have become indispensable for identifying areas that require improvement and measuring the effectiveness of implemented strategies. HOST: I see. As someone who teaches Quality Improvement, what challenges do you face in helping students grasp these concepts? GUEST: The biggest challenge is making sure students understand the practical application of these theories. It's one thing to learn about Lean methodologies or Six Sigma in a classroom setting, but applying them to real-world scenarios can be challenging. HOST: That's understandable.
